D20 Future ain't bad, but I'm a big fan of Bulldogs! by Galileo Games too. Rumor has it they are thinking of doing a 3.75 update to their rules in fact. Some people dig on Mongoose's Traveler as well. True 20 is pretty sleek, and I think they have a Future update do they not?

Anyone else have any faves?

You can get a combined book of Books 1-3 of the original edition of Traveller at www.TravellerRPG.com (I think it's about US$12 but the current price will be there) and they have links to the Far Future website where there are other things available. The Mongoose edition of Traveller is now in print but T5 itself is still being worked on and there is no ETA at present (the fan consensus was "take your time and get it right").
